What is the cheapest way to build a small house?

The cheapest way to build a home is to design a simple box. Sticking to a square or rectangle makes the building and design simple. Generally speaking, building up is cheaper than building a sprawling one-story home, so you may want to consider planning for a multiple-story home if you need more space.

Can you build a home for 50k?

There are many factors that strongly suggest you can’t build a house for $50,000 in in the 21st century U.S. Among them are these: Land and permit costs often cost almost as much as your total budget. To come close to building a house on a $50,000 budget, you’ll have to cut many corners.

Can you get a permit after work is done?

If your contractor completes work without a permit, you’ll be responsible for footing the bill after the fact. You can file for a permit after the work is complete, but it’s unfortunately going to cost you some extra money.

How much does it cost to build a small house?

A small home that’s around 1,000 square feet will cost around $100,000 to $200,000 to build but could cost upwards of $300,000 in cities with high costs of living. Tiny houses are usually between 60 and 400 square feet but there’s no rule for how “tiny” a home has to be.
